parent
e6af2ed9be
commit
058bc1b16d
@ -0,0 +1,9 @@
|
|||||||
|
import request from "@/utils/request";
|
||||||
|
|
||||||
|
export function getOatoken(params){
|
||||||
|
return request({
|
||||||
|
method:'get',
|
||||||
|
url:'/api/admin/oa/get-oa-token',
|
||||||
|
params
|
||||||
|
})
|
||||||
|
}
|
||||||
@ -0,0 +1,68 @@
|
|||||||
|
<template>
|
||||||
|
<div class="container">
|
||||||
|
<!-- 查询配置 -->
|
||||||
|
<div style="padding: 0px 20px">
|
||||||
|
<iframe v-if="showiframe" ref="iframe" :src="url" width="100%" :height="myHeight+'px'" frameborder="0"></iframe>
|
||||||
|
|
||||||
|
<!-- <div ref="lxHeader">
|
||||||
|
<LxHeader icon="md-apps" text="法律法规" style="margin-bottom: 10px; border: 0px;">
|
||||||
|
<div slot="content"></div>
|
||||||
|
|
||||||
|
</LxHeader>
|
||||||
|
</div> -->
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
</div>
|
||||||
|
</div>
|
||||||
|
|
||||||
|
</template>
|
||||||
|
|
||||||
|
<script>
|
||||||
|
import LxHeader from "@/components/LxHeader/index.vue";
|
||||||
|
|
||||||
|
import {
|
||||||
|
getOatoken
|
||||||
|
} from "@/api/oatoken";
|
||||||
|
|
||||||
|
export default {
|
||||||
|
components: {
|
||||||
|
LxHeader
|
||||||
|
},
|
||||||
|
created() {},
|
||||||
|
mounted() {
|
||||||
|
this.myHeight = window.innerHeight * 0.95
|
||||||
|
let that = this;
|
||||||
|
this.openOa()
|
||||||
|
},
|
||||||
|
data() {
|
||||||
|
return {
|
||||||
|
myHeight: 0,
|
||||||
|
url: '',
|
||||||
|
showiframe: false
|
||||||
|
}
|
||||||
|
},
|
||||||
|
methods: {
|
||||||
|
async openOa(row) {
|
||||||
|
let res = await getOatoken()
|
||||||
|
this.url =
|
||||||
|
`${process.env.VUE_APP_OUT_URL}/oa/admin/regulation/show?category_id=38&oatoken=${res.oatoken}`
|
||||||
|
this.showiframe = true
|
||||||
|
},
|
||||||
|
}
|
||||||
|
};
|
||||||
|
</script>
|
||||||
|
|
||||||
|
<style>
|
||||||
|
.dialogConcent {
|
||||||
|
overflow-y: auto;
|
||||||
|
}
|
||||||
|
|
||||||
|
.el-tree-node__label {
|
||||||
|
text-wrap: wrap;
|
||||||
|
}
|
||||||
|
|
||||||
|
.el-tree-node__content {
|
||||||
|
height: auto;
|
||||||
|
}
|
||||||
|
</style>
|
||||||
Loading…
Reference in new issue